He was always intending to ask for a kiss.
In the beginning of Episode 162, when Khushi asked him to slap her, Arnav stepped up real close, stared at her, and her lips, and then said - Drop it. Let it be. You won’t be able to take it.
He wasn’t talking about a slap. Even Khushi could tell.
I think that’s when the idea germinated and he actively began to plan ways to make Khushi Kumari Gupta kiss him.
When we get to the scene you’re asking about in Episode 165, I think the look on his face says it all. He was definitely planning to ask for a kiss.
When she won the Sangeet, he had to come up with a new way to get what he wanted -- hence the bet. I think Arnav clearly had a goal in mind and there was no way he was letting the Payash wedding happen without progressing what he and Khushi shared to the next stage.
